WebThe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act (FD&C Act) is a federal law enacted by Congress. It and other federal laws establish the legal framework within which FDA operates. WebApr 11, 2024 · The Modernization of Cosmetics Regulation Act of 2024 (MoCRA) went into effect with US President Joe Biden's signing of the Consolidated Appropriations Act, 2024. This legislation will profoundly change the way cosmetic companies interact with the US Food & Drug Administration (FDA).

Section 3. WebSep 12, 2024 · Section 408 of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act (FFDCA) authorizes EPA to set tolerances, or maximum residue limits, for pesticide residues on foods. In the absence of a tolerance for a pesticide residue, a food containing such a residue is subject to seizure by the government. Once a tolerance is established, the residue level in the ...
